General | |
Device Type: | Graphics card |
Bus Type: | PCI Express 4.0 |
Graphics Engine: | NVIDIA GeForce RTX 3060 |
Boost Clock: | 1807 MHz |
CUDA Cores: | 3584 |
Max Resolution: | 7680 x 4320 |
Max Monitors Supported: | 4 |
Interfaces Details: | HDMI ¦ 3 x DisplayPort |
API Supported: | OpenGL 4.6, DirectX 12 Ultimate |
Features: | 2.5-slot Fan Cooler, Dual ball Bearing Fan, NVIDIA G-Sync ready, AUTO-EXTREME technology, GPU Tweak II, Real-Time Ray Tracing, Axial-tech Fan Design, 0dB Technology, Nvidia DLSS, Nvidia Studio, NVIDIA Ampere GPU technology, NVIDIA Reflex, 2nd gen Ray Tracing Cores, 3rd gen Tensor Cores, HDCP |
Memory | |
Size: | 12 GB |
Technology: | GDDR6 SDRAM |
Memory Speed: | 15 Gbps |
Bus Width: | 192-bit |
System Requirements | |
Required Power Supply: | 650 W |
Additional Requirements: | 8 pin PCI Express power connector |
Miscellaneous | |
Included Accessories: | Collection card |
Software Included: | XSplit Gamecaster 2 (1 year Premium licence), WTFast Gamers Private Network (6 months Premium licence), ASUS Quantumcloud |
Compliant Standards: | HDCP 2.3, DisplayPort 1.4a |
Width: | 5.1 cm |
Depth: | 17.7 cm |
Height: | 12.8 cm |
The ASUS Phoenix GeForce RTX 3060 V2 brings ultra high frame rates for today's most popular titles.
- NVIDIA Ampere Streaming Multiprocessors: the building blocks for the world's fastest, most efficient GPUs, the all-new Ampere SM brings 2X the FP32 throughput and improved power efficiency
- 2nd Generation RT Cores: experience 2X the throughput of 1st gen RT Cores, plus concurrent RT and shading for a whole new level of ray tracing performance
- 3rd Generation Tensor Cores: get up to 2X the throughput with structural sparsity and advanced AI algorithms such as DLSS
- Axial-tech fan design has been tuned up with more fan blades and a reversed rotational direction for the center fan
- Dual ball fan bearings can last up to twice as long as sleeve bearing designs
- Auto-Extreme Technology uses automation to enhance reliability
- A protective backplate prevents PCB flex and trace damage
